Adv 2.0 D&D Phase 10 SUB2a-ii: Battle Master + Assassin L5/L7

Battle Master:
  - New "superiority" resource pool (4/long-rest at L5), provisioned via
    initSubclassResources at !subclass selection.
  - Three armed maneuvers fueled by superiority dice:
    * Precision Attack — +d8 (≈+4) to first attack roll
    * Tripping Attack  — enemy skips first attack (reuses Phase 9
      SpellEnemySkipFirst)
    * Rally            — +(d8 + CHA) HealItem at <50% HP
  - L7 Know Your Enemy proxied as +1 AttackBonus passive.

Assassin:
  - L5 Assassinate: AssassinateAdvantage (re-roll first miss, take better
    of two d20s) + AssassinateBonusDmg = level (5 at L5) stacked on top
    of the Rogue's existing Sneak Attack auto-crit.
  - L7 Impostor bumps the bonus damage by +3.
  - L5 Infiltration Expertise → +5 Deception; L7 Impostor → +10.

Engine:
  - CombatModifiers gains FirstAttackBonus, AssassinateAdvantage,
    AssassinateBonusDmg.
  - resolvePlayerAttack consumes each on the first attack only via new
    combatState one-shot flags.

Tests added: 14 covering passive gating (BM L7+, Assassin L5/L7),
maneuver Apply flags, superiority pool init for BM only, !arm gating
across class/subclass for precision_attack, Deception bonus tiers,
statistical lift from FirstAttackBonus and AssassinateBonusDmg in
SimulateCombat.
